# Dedup script that submits deduping jobs after splitting at known
# non-duplicate
# Juicer version 2.0
BEGIN{
tot=0;
name=0;
if (justexact) {
str="-v nowobble=1";
}
else {
str="-v wobble1="wobbleDist" -v wobble2="wobbleDist;
}
}
{
if (tot >= 1000000 && $0 ~/cb:/) {
for (ind=12; ind<=NF; ind++) {
if ($(ind) ~ /^cb:/) {
split($(ind), cb_str, ":");
}
}
split(cb_str[3], cb, "_");
if (p1 != cb[1] || p2 != cb[2] || p3 != int(cb[3]) || p4 != int(cb[4]) || p5 != cb[5] || p6 != cb[6]) {
sname = sprintf("%s_msplit%04d", groupname, name);
sscriptname = sprintf("%s/.%s.slurm", debugdir, sname);
printf("#!/bin/bash -l\n#SBATCH -o %s/dup-split-%s.out\n#SBATCH -e %s/dup-split-%s.err\n#SBATCH -p %s\n#SBATCH -J %s_msplit0\n#SBATCH -t 1440\n#SBATCH -c 1\n#SBATCH --ntasks=1\ndate;awk -f %s/scripts/dups_sam.awk %s %s/split%04d > %s/%s;\necho Reads:%s\ndate\n", debugdir, name, debugdir, name, queue, groupname, juicedir, str, dir, name, dir, sname, tot) > sscriptname;
sysstring = sprintf("sbatch %s", sscriptname);
system(sysstring);
outname = sprintf("%s/split%04d", dir, name);
close(outname);
close(sscriptname);
name++;
tot=0;
}
}
outname = sprintf("%s/split%04d", dir, name);
print > outname;
if ( $0 ~ /cb:/) {
for (ind=12; ind<=NF; ind++) {
if ($(ind) ~ /^cb:/) {
split($(ind), cb_str, ":");
}
}
split(cb_str[3], cb, "_");
p1=cb[1];p2=cb[2];p3=int(cb[3]);p4=int(cb[4]);p5=cb[5];p6=cb[6];
}
tot++;
}
END {
sname = sprintf("%s_msplit%04d", groupname, name);
sscriptname = sprintf("%s/.%s.slurm", debugdir, sname);
printf("#!/bin/bash -l\n#SBATCH -o %s/dup-split-%s.out\n#SBATCH -e %s/dup-split-%s.err\n#SBATCH -p %s\n#SBATCH -J %s_msplit0\n#SBATCH -t 1440\n#SBATCH -c 1\n#SBATCH --ntasks=1\ndate;awk -f %s/scripts/dups_sam.awk %s %s/split%04d > %s/%s;\necho Reads:%s\ndate\n", debugdir, name, debugdir, name, queue, groupname, juicedir, str, dir, name, dir, sname, tot) > sscriptname;
sysstring = sprintf("sbatch %s", sscriptname);
system(sysstring);
close(sscriptname);
sscriptname = sprintf("%s/.%s_msplit.slurm", debugdir, groupname);
printf("#!/bin/bash -l\n#SBATCH -o %s/dup-merge.out\n#SBATCH -e %s/dup-merge.err\n#SBATCH --mem=50G\n#SBATCH -p %s\n#SBATCH -J %s_msplit0\n#SBATCH -d singleton\n#SBATCH -t 1440\n#SBATCH -c 1\n#SBATCH --ntasks=1\ndate;\necho \"\"; cat %s/%s_msplit* > %s/merged_dedup.sam;\n date\n", debugdir, debugdir, queue, groupname, dir, groupname, dir) > sscriptname;
sysstring = sprintf("sbatch %s", sscriptname);
system(sysstring);
close(sscriptname);
sscriptname = sprintf("%s/.%s_finalize.slurm", debugdir, groupname);
printf("#!/bin/bash -l\n#SBATCH -o %s/dup-guard-trigger.out\n#SBATCH -e %s/dup-guard-trigger.err\n#SBATCH -p %s\n#SBATCH -J %s_msplit0\n#SBATCH -d singleton\n#SBATCH -t 1440\n#SBATCH -c 1\n#SBATCH --ntasks=1\necho %s %s %s %s;\nsqueue -u %s;\ndate\n", debugdir, debugdir, queue, groupname, topDir, site, genomeID, genomePath, user, user) > sscriptname;
sysstring = sprintf("sbatch %s", sscriptname);
system(sysstring);
(sysstring | getline maildupid);
var = gensub("[^0-9]", "", "g", maildupid);
sysstring = sprintf("scontrol update JobID=%s dependency=afterok:%s", guardjid, var);
system(sysstring);
close(sscriptname);
sscriptname = sprintf("%s/.%s_mail.slurm", debugdir, groupname);
printf("#!/bin/bash -l\n#SBATCH -o %s/dup-mail.out\n#SBATCH -e %s/dup-mail.err\n#SBATCH -p %s\n#SBATCH -J %s_msplit0\n#SBATCH -d singleton\n#SBATCH -t 1440\n#SBATCH -c 1\n#SBATCH --ntasks=1\ndate;\necho %s %s %s %s | mail -r [email protected] -s \"Juicer pipeline finished successfully @ Voltron\" -t %[email protected];\ndate\n", debugdir, debugdir, queue, groupname, topDir, site, genomeID, genomePath, user) > sscriptname;
sysstring = sprintf("sbatch %s", sscriptname);
system(sysstring);
close(sscriptname);
}
